• (学)如何在Oracle中一次执行多条sql语句

    时间:2024-04-17 20:01:06

    队长同学原来的地址:https://www.cnblogs.com/teamleader/archive/2007/05/31/765943.html队长同学原来的描述:有时我们需要一次性执行多条sql语句,而用来更新的sql是根据实际情况用代码拼出来的解决方案是把sql拼成下面这种形式:begin...

  • mysql 事务中如果有sql语句出错,会导致自动回滚吗?

    时间:2024-04-17 09:48:56

    事务,我们都知道具有原子性,操作要么全部成功,要么全部失败。但是有可能会造成误解。我们先准备一张表,来进行测试CREATE TABLE `name` ( `id` int(11) unsigned NOT NULL AUTO_INCREMENT COMMENT 'ID', `name` varc...

  • MyBatis一次执行多条SQL语句

    时间:2024-04-17 09:47:21

    MyBatis一次执行多条SQL语句有个常见的场景:删除用户的时候需要先删除用户的外键关联数据,否则会触发规则报错。解决办法不外乎有三个:1、多条sql分批执行;2、存储过程或函数调用;3、sql批量执行。今天我要说的是MyBatis中如何一次执行多条语句(使用mysql数据库)。1、修改数据库连接...

  • C#实现执行多条SQl语句,实现数据库事务

    时间:2024-04-17 09:35:59

    C#实现执行多条SQl语句,实现数据库事务在数据库中使用事务的好处,相信大家都有听过银行存款的交易作为事务的一个例子。事务处理可以确保除非事务性单元内的所有操作都成功完成,否则不会永久更新面向数据的资源。通过将一组相关操作组合为一个要么全部成功要么全部失败的单元,可以简化错误恢复并使用应用程序更加可

  • Jenkins工程中SQL语句执行的方法

    时间:2024-04-17 09:34:11

    前言网上很多jenkins工程中基于shell或批处理方式调用sql文件执行sql命令的方式,大部分都是需要基于sql文件来完成的,因此在sql语句发生变化时需要去jenkins服务端修改对应的sql文件或者通过上传的方式进行替换,对于多人协助相对比较麻烦,为了解决此问题,本方法是基于groovy对...

  • 用一条SQL语句取出第 m 条到第 n 条记录的方法

    时间:2024-04-17 09:20:30

    原文:用一条SQL语句取出第 m 条到第 n 条记录的方法  --从Table 表中取出第 m 条到第 n 条的记录:(Not In 版本)    SELECT TOP n-m+1 *   FROM Table   WHERE (id NOT IN (SELECT TOP m-1 id FROM T...

  • MySQL的EXPLAIN命令用于SQL语句的查询执行计划

    时间:2024-04-17 09:11:40

    MySQL的EXPLAIN命令用于SQL语句的查询执行计划(QEP)。这条命令的输出结果能够让我们了解MySQL 优化器是如何执行SQL 语句的。这条命令并没有提供任何调整建议,但它能够提供重要的信息帮助你做出调优决策。语法MySQL 的EXPLAIN 语法可以运行在SELECT 语句或者特定表上。...

  • JavaWeb 学习007-4个页面,5条sql语句(添加、查看、修改、删除)2016-12-2

    时间:2024-04-17 09:08:32

    需要复习的知识: 关联查询=================================================================================班级模块学生模块课程模块爱好模块用户信息模块一个项目最开始要做的是 tbuser的编写,这对应着登录。每一个模...

  • JavaWeb 学习009-4个页面,5条sql语句(添加、查看、修改、删除)

    时间:2024-04-17 09:02:25

    ===========++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++==+++++++++2016-12-3---------------------------------------------------------...

  • sql语句执行步骤详解

    时间:2024-04-17 07:42:40

    一、准备工作先来一段伪代码,首先你能看懂么?SELECT DISTINCT <select_list>FROM <left_table><join_type> JOIN <right_table>ON <join_condition>WHE...

  • 【故障公告】再次遭遇SQL语句执行超时引发网站首页访问故障

    时间:2024-04-16 23:35:17

    非常抱歉,昨天 18:40~19:10 再次遭遇上次遇到的 SQL 语句执行超时引发的网站首页访问故障,由此您带来麻烦,请您谅解。上次故障详见之前的故障公告,上次排查下来以为是 SQL Server 参数嗅探问题引起的,但在引起参数嗅探的漏洞被修复后再次出现故障说明上次的判断是错误的。今天出现故障时...

  • Oracle SQL语句执行步骤

    时间:2024-04-16 23:34:59

    转自:http://www.cnblogs.com/quanweiru/archive/2012/11/09/2762345.htmlOracle中SQL语句执行过程中,Oracle内部解析原理如下:1、当一用户第一次提交一个SQL表达式时,Oracle会将这SQL进行Hard parse,这过程有...

  • SQL语句执行性能

    时间:2024-04-16 23:21:27

    通过设置STATISTICS我们可以查看执行SQL时的系统情况。选项有PROFILE,IO ,TIME。介绍如下:SET STATISTICS PROFILE ON:显示分析、编译和执行查询所需的时间(以毫秒为单位)。 SET STATISTICS IO ON:报告与语句内引用的每个表的扫描数、逻辑...

  • Oracle sql语句执行顺序

    时间:2024-04-16 23:11:41

    sql语法的分析是从右到左一、sql语句的执行步骤:1)词法分析,词法分析阶段是编译过程的第一个阶段。这个阶段的任务是从左到右一个字符一个字符地读入源程序,即对构成源程序的字符流进行扫描然后根据构词规则识别单词(也称单词符号或符号)。词法分析程序实现这个任务。词法分析程序可以使用lex等工具自动生成...

  • SQL语句执行与结果集的获取

    时间:2024-04-16 22:39:05

    title: SQL语句执行与结果集的获取tags: [OLEDB, 数据库编程, VC++, 数据库]date: 2018-01-28 09:22:10categories: windows 数据库编程keywords: OLEDB, 数据库编程, VC++, 数据库,执行SQL, 获取结果集上次...

  • 执行sql查询,并查看语句执行花费时间

    时间:2024-04-16 22:33:47

    declare @d datetimeset @d=getdate()select * from APRINT '[语句执行花费时间(毫秒)]'+LTRIM(datediff(ms,@d,getdate()))

  • 一条SQL语句是如何执行的?--Mysql45讲笔记记录 打卡day1

    时间:2024-04-16 21:52:46

    写在前面的话:回想以前上班的时候,空闲时间还是挺多的,但是都荒废了。如今找工作着实费劲了。但是这段时间在极客时间买了mysql45讲,就好像发现了新大陆一样,这是我认真做笔记的第一天,说实话第一讲我已经看了有5遍了吧。今晚认真读了一遍也思考了一遍,打算做一下记录,也让自己再回想一遍,加深印象。其实第...

  • 一条SQL语句获取具有父子关系的分类列表(mysql)

    时间:2024-04-16 21:41:32

    有如下表数据:获取“菜单”分类的子分类数据列表:SELECT a.cat_id, a.cat_name, a.sort_order AS parent_order, a.cat_id, b.cat_id AS child_id, b.cat_name AS child_nameFROM articl...

  • SQL查询语句:关于时间的比较

    时间:2024-04-16 16:49:13

            1、简单查询:select * from tablename where logtime>=\'2006/5/11 00:00:00.000\' and logtime<=\'2006/5/11 23:...

  • ThinkPHP框架 系统规定的方法查询数据库内容!!同时也支持原生的SQL语句!

    时间:2024-04-16 14:40:14

    <?phpnamespace Admin\Controller;use Think\Controller;class MainController extends Controller{ public function test(){ $nation = M("nation...